Summary

From raging ex-cons on the streets of L.A. to cold-blooded crime sprees in Chicago, nail-biting suspense make this classic collection of murder, crime, and horror stories a thrilling audio experience not soon forgotten. Acclaimed writers— past and present— such as James Ellroy, Stephen King, Elmore Leonard, and Ellery Queen, deliver the best in short story crime and mystery fiction:

• “ The Perfect Crime” by Ben Ray Redman, read by Dan Lauria
• “ Quitters, Inc.” by Stephen King, read by Eric Roberts
• “ High Darktown” by James Ellroy, read by Arte Johnson
• “ Yours Truly, Jack the Ripper” by Robert Bloch, read by Robert Forster
• “ Clerical Error” by James Gould Cozzens, read by Jamie Farr
• “ The Gettysburg Bugle” by Ellery Queen, read by Jason Priestly
• “ Last Spin” by Evan Hunter, read by David Paymer
• “ Karen Makes Out” by Elmore Leonard, read by Mario Machado
• “ The Problem of Cell 13” by Jacques Futrelle, read by Richard Cox
